This is the Pura Vita ABS edgebanding in Rovere Firenze (PVRF04), cut to a 23 mm width and supplied on a 328-foot production roll. It is the color-matched companion to the Pura Vita Rovere Firenze panel, finishing every cut edge in the same Natural Firenze Oak soft brushed decor so face and edge read as one continuous surface.
Rovere Firenze is a warm, linear oak decor with a soft brushed texture — the kind of finish that shows up on contemporary kitchen door fronts, wardrobe carcasses, and open shelving where the edge is as visible as the face. A panel that arrives with a matched edge already covered needs no second-guessing at the edgebander: load the roll, set the trim, and every piece that comes off the machine matches. The 328-foot length is the right choice when a full kitchen's worth of panels — upper cabinets, lower cabinets, and tall units — all pull from the same color. Stopping to splice mid-run wastes time and risks a gloss-line difference at the joint.
ABS edgebanding is chlorine-free, which matters on jobs where the specification rules PVC out — LEED work, healthcare interiors, and some European-origin millwork specs routinely carry that restriction. Beyond compliance, ABS holds its color consistency and dimensions better across the humidity swings of an active shop. The soft brushed finish on this roll is the same treatment applied to the Pura Vita veneer panel face: a light mechanical brushing that lifts the soft grain just enough to add tactile depth and catch light along the grain line without opening the pore aggressively. The result is an edge that reads as wood, not as a flat film.
Cabinet shops running Pura Vita Rovere Firenze panels as a house color are the core buyer: one roll in the rack means the color is always ready when an order drops. Millwork operations building custom closet and wardrobe systems in a contemporary oak palette rely on the production roll length to avoid mid-run restocking. Designers specifying a brushed natural oak throughout a full interior — panels, doors, and carcasses — will find this the reliable way to keep every edge consistent with the face. If the run is a single cabinet or a repair, consider whether a shorter roll serves the job better; the 328-foot length is engineered for volume.
This roll is unglued and is applied with a standard hot-melt edgebander. It is not an iron-on product. If your shop uses a glue-pot machine or a portable bander with a cartridge system, confirm the adhesive is compatible with ABS before running the first piece.
The banding is produced by SALT International to match the Pura Vita PVRF04 panel in both decor and finish treatment. Because the veneer panel face carries natural variation by construction, the banding is designed to read as the same surface family rather than a photographic duplicate of any one sheet. For a finished installation, the match is consistent and intentional.
A 23 mm band is the standard match for a 19 mm panel — it leaves enough overhang on both faces to trim flush cleanly. If your Pura Vita panels run at a different thickness, verify the band width before ordering.
Matching high pressure laminate is not part of the Pura Vita program. If the job needs to carry the color onto a countertop or a surface the panel does not cover, the ABS edgebanding is the matching component the collection supports.
